The client is seeking a Director, Medical Monitor to provide medical oversight for assigned clinical studies from start-up through closeout. This role will support protocol development and amendments, informed consent review, and preparation of clinical study reports. The Director, Medical Monitor will serve as the primary medical contact for investigators and study sites for protocol-related questions, including subject eligibility and enrollment guidance.
Key responsibilities include conducting ongoing medical review of subject safety data, eligibility determinations, protocol deviations, and emerging risk signals to help ensure patient safety and scientific integrity. The role will review and interpret clinical data and trends, including safety data, laboratory values, adverse events, and protocol deviations, and will support dose escalation decisions and safety review meetings where applicable. The Director, Medical Monitor will also provide medical training and support for site initiation visits, investigator meetings, monitoring activities, and data review committees as needed.
The Director, Medical Monitor will collaborate with pharmacovigilance teams on safety reporting requirements, safety management plans, and risk mitigation strategies, escalating safety concerns when needed. The role will work with clinical operations to help ensure studies are conducted in compliance with GCP, SOPs, and regulatory guidance, and will partner with regulatory affairs on regulatory submissions and responses to regulatory agencies. Required qualifications include an MD or DO with board eligible/certified preference, infectious diseases expertise preferred, and clinical drug development experience with Phase 1–4 study design, conduct, and analysis, along with strong understanding of ICH-GCP and applicable regulatory requirements; additional clinical research training and willingness to travel up to 25% for study activities are also expected.
